  6. 4. Marcus Aurelius. Known as the 'philosopher emperor', Marcus Aurelius ruled from 161 to 180 CE. He is considered one of the most exceptional Roman emperors due to his philosophical contributions, his dedication to the empire's welfare, and his ability to balance military and administrative duties.
